Ticks and clothes lines

I've just come home from vacation. This was a family vacation, with some of the immediate family and some of the extended family close by, each in their own place.

I brought Pusur. Let's just say I'll find an alternative next year... But anyway, each night I checked him for ticks and never found any.

But my mom caught one! On her butt!!!!

Best guess is that a tick got into one of her knickers (under pants) as they were hanging drying on a clothes line at the edge of a thicket with several large trees.

Ouch!

I had a special tick remover pincers, so got it out. It was alive and kicking after the fact. Her butt sports a large red area.

Moral of the story? Be careful with hanging your clothes out to dry in tick related areas!
